[v2,4/6] clocksource/drivers/tegra: Drop unneeded typecasting in one place

There is no need to cast void because kernel allows to do that without
a warning message from a compiler.

Patch

diff --git a/drivers/clocksource/timer-tegra.c b/drivers/clocksource/timer-tegra.c
index 646b3530c2d2..a7fa12488066 100644
--- a/drivers/clocksource/timer-tegra.c
+++ b/drivers/clocksource/timer-tegra.c
@@ -81,7 +81,7 @@  static int tegra_timer_set_periodic(struct clock_event_device *evt)
 
 static irqreturn_t tegra_timer_isr(int irq, void *dev_id)
 {
-	struct clock_event_device *evt = (struct clock_event_device *)dev_id;
+	struct clock_event_device *evt = dev_id;
 	void __iomem *reg_base = timer_of_base(to_timer_of(evt));
 
 	writel_relaxed(TIMER_PCR_INTR_CLR, reg_base + TIMER_PCR);
